Window hardware can face various issues, frequently causing lowered performance or complete breakdown. Some of the most common problems include:
Sticking or Stuck Windows: This problem often happens due to dirt accumulation, painted hardware, or bent frames.
Broken or Missing Locks: This can jeopardize security and needs to be attended to promptly.
Damaged Weather Stripping: Deteriorated weather removing cause drafts and increased energy costs.
Faulty Hinges: These can trigger windows to sag or not open properly.
Cracked or Damaged Sashes: If a sash is not undamaged, the window may not operate correctly.
Faulty Crank Mechanism: In casement windows, a malfunctioning crank can prevent the opening and closing of the Quality Window Doctor.
Steps to Repair Window Hardware
Fixing window hardware includes a range of skills and tools. Here are some general steps for addressing common Mobile Window Doctor hardware problems.
1. Guarantee Safety First
Before starting any repair work, make sure security by:
Wearing gloves and protective eyewear.Utilizing a sturdy ladder for high windows.Turning off any connected electrical power if you need to work near wiring.2. Determine the Problem
Examine the window Hardware repair and its hardware thoroughly to identify the particular concern. Look for signs of wear, rust, or misalignment. When identified, describe the above lists of common problems to determine the needed repair work.
3. Collect Necessary Tools and Materials
Having the right tools and products on hand will make the repair process smoother. Common tools needed include:
Screwdrivers (flathead and Phillips)PliersAn utility knifeReplacement parts (e.g., locks, hinges, weather stripping)Wood glue (for loose sashes)Sandpaper (for rough edges)4. Execute RepairsSticking WindowsTidy the Sash and Frame: Remove any dirt carefully.Change or Sand: If it's a paint problem, carefully sand down the edges for a smoother operation.Broken LocksReplace the Lock: Unscrew the old lock and set up a brand-new one. Ensure that it fits comfortably and works well.Worn-Out Weather StrippingRemove Old Stripping: Use an energy knife to cut the old weather condition stripping.Include New Stripping: Measure the window to cut fresh weather condition removing and secure it onto the frame.Faulty HingesTighten or Replace Hinges: If loose, just tighten up the screws. If harmed, get rid of the old hinge and set up a new one.Harmed SashesRepair Loose Sashes: Use wood glue and clamps to secure them. For fractures, think about utilizing epoxy resin.Malfunctioning Crank MechanismCheck and Replace Crank: If the crank doesn't turn, take apart the system and change it with a brand-new, compatible one.5. Evaluate the Repairs
After making the required repairs, test the window numerous times to guarantee that it works correctly. This consists of opening, closing, locking, and examining for drafts.
Maintenance Tips for Window Hardware
To prevent additional issues with window hardware, routine maintenance is vital. Here are some pointers to keep windows in good condition:
Regular Cleaning: Keep the frame and sash clean to avoid sticking.Oil Moving Parts: Use silicone spray or graphite powder on hinges and locks to decrease friction.Check Weather Stripping: At least twice a year, check and change weather condition removing if worn.Screen for Damage: Regularly examine for indications of rust, damage, or misalignment in hardware.Trigger Repairs: Address any problems as quickly as they emerge to prevent more extensive damage in the future.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: How frequently should I check my window hardware?
A1: Inspect your window hardware at least twice a year, ideally before the beginning of winter season and summer season.
Q2: Can I repair window hardware myself?
A2: Yes, numerous Window Doctor Uk hardware issues can be fixed with basic tools and abilities. Nevertheless, for complex problems or if you're unsure, consider seeking advice from a professional.
Q3: What should I do if my window will not open at all?
A3: Identify if the issue is with the hardware or frame. If you can't find a service, looking for professional help may be essential.
Q4: Is it worth it to change old hardware?
A4: If the hardware is causing substantial problems or inadequacy, changing it can improve window function and potentially minimize energy costs.
Q5: What are some signs that my window hardware requires repair?
A5: Signs consist of difficulty opening or closing windows, gaps that enable drafts, broken locks, or visible rust and corrosion.
